Output 2898a666f03c796a80d4265a3ea65d1e42e524e3a66fabacf7f923c4df0d8911:40

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 0bb12ae271d5a9ec97551bef4cf62fdb2d45bff0
address
tb1qpwcj4cn36k57e964r0h5ea30mvk5t0lszjcc9v
transaction
2898a666f03c796a80d4265a3ea65d1e42e524e3a66fabacf7f923c4df0d8911
confirmations
28862
spent
true